Output 58a8d9d0d95ab00aa43f0b6303aec2782759fc451de7a62bf77653e184ad0ec1:0

value
29110393423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5976d76ac3c5974ffa0ca0fa2714ee3e06666786 OP_EQUALVERIFY OP_CHECKSIG
address
DDJ93agtZc1xbM3qKR83FYvvDGJAdc2Z33
transaction
58a8d9d0d95ab00aa43f0b6303aec2782759fc451de7a62bf77653e184ad0ec1